		<description>You must set the USBAsp to Slow SCK to read/write to the AVR at 1MHz. Otherwise, eXtreme Burner has no problem in itself regarding this. This is a common issue with USBAsp to set SCK jumper properly for slow speed.</description>

		<description>For those who use proteus ISM for simulation:

- Program does not work well with proteus, there is a bug in simulation tool which does not work well with this function in I2C.C, I2CStop() function:

//Wait for STOP to finish
while(TWCR &amp; (1&lt;&lt;TWSTO));

Replace this by this:

//Wait for STOP to finish
_delay_loop_2(500);

It will work.

Do not update library code while working with hardware. There is a bug in proteus not with code.</description>
